What documents should I bring to the open house?

You must be equipped with:

  • Originals and photocopies (as many copies as the number of open houses you will attend) of your 3 1st grade transcripts.
  • Originals and photocopies (as many as the number of open houses you will attend) of your senior year transcripts (all those already in your possession if you are only a senior).
  • Originals and photocopies (as many copies as the number of open houses you will attend) of your baccalaureate transcript if you have already passed it.
  • Originals and photocopies (as many copies as the number of open houses you will attend) of your baccalaureate diploma if you have already passed it.
  • Copy of your credencial application if you have already done so.
  • Receipt of payment of your entrance test fees if you have to pay them (UCJC and UAX)
  • The original and photocopies (as many copies as the number of open days you will attend) of your valid identity document.
  • The original and photocopies (as many copies as the number of open days you will attend) of an official certificate of your level of Spanish if you have one.
  • The application form if there is one to be filled out for the university (UEV, UCJC, UEM) to which you are applying.
